PAIR TIFFANY & CO. 'UTOWANA' PLATED BUTTER PATS Pair of Tiffany & Co. (American 1837), silverplate butter pats, each having a gadrooned rim and engraved 'Utowana', with stamped maker's marks to the back of each. Note: These butter pats were used aboard Mr. Allison Vincent Armour's (American 1863-1941) research steamer yacht 'Utowana'. Provenance: From the Private Collection of Tania Armour Becker, Atlanta, Georgia. Approximate dimensions: dia. 3.5".
